Description

Glenfarclas 10 Year 750ML is a Speyside single malt Scotch whisky bottled at 40% ABV in a 750ml format, aged for a full decade in sherry-seasoned oak. Backed by an International Spirits Challenge Gold medal and a TAG Global Spirits Awards Gold, this ten-year-old expression showcases the distillery's long commitment to sherry-cask maturation and traditional direct-fire distillation — two hallmarks that define the Glenfarclas house style.

Quick Facts: ABV: 40%  |  Origin: Speyside, Scotland  |  10 Year Age Statement  |  Distillery: Glenfarclas

Production & Heritage

Glenfarclas Distillery, established in 1836 in Ballindalloch on the slopes of Ben Rinnes, has been owned by the Grant family since 1865 — making it one of the few remaining independent, family-run distilleries in Scotland, now in its sixth generation of stewardship. The 10 Year Old is distilled from 100% malted barley in traditional copper pot stills heated by direct gas fire, a method the distillery famously reinstated after briefly trialling steam coils in 1981 when they found the spirit lost its characteristic richness. Roughly 60% of the cask mix for this expression comes from first-fill sherry butts, with the remainder being refill sherry casks, yielding a markedly fruit-forward and malty spirit at just ten years of age.

Tasting Notes

Aroma: Honeyed malt leads, followed by green apple and toffee, then sherry-sweet undertones laced with subtle spice. A gentle warmth rises as the whisky opens up in the glass.

Taste: The entry is soft and malty with immediate sherry sweetness. At mid-palate, dried fruit expands alongside citrus oil, vanilla, and a dusting of cinnamon and clove. The flavors are layered but never heavy, with the direct-fire distillate providing a sturdy, full-bodied backbone.

Finish: Medium to long, smooth and warming, with lingering spice and gentle sherried fruit fading into soft oak. A pleasant malty sweetness stays behind well after the last sip.

Why Glenfarclas 10?

What sets this whisky apart begins in the stillhouse: Glenfarclas is one of a very small number of Scottish distilleries still using direct-fire heating beneath their pot stills, a method that produces a heavier, more characterful new-make spirit capable of standing up to aggressive sherry-cask influence. The unusually high proportion of first-fill sherry butts — approximately 60% of the vatting — gives the 10 Year Old a depth of dried fruit and spice that many competitors only achieve at 12 or 15 years. Backed by Gold medals at both the International Spirits Challenge and TAG Global Spirits Awards, and produced by a distillery named Scottish Distillery of the Year at the 2020 Icons of Whisky awards, this is a ten-year-old single malt punching well above its age statement. For drinkers exploring sherry-cask Scotch, it remains one of the most honest and rewarding entry points in the category.
